Umpires Use Instant Replay, Still Blow Call In Twins-Rays Game (Video)

by abournenesn

Apr 23, 2014

Yunel Escobar struck out Tuesday night on a 4-2 count.

That’s right, a 4-2 count.

The confusion in the Minnesota Twins-Tampa Bay Rays game began when Escobar appeared to foul-tip a pitch past the catcher, but he actually didn’t make contact with the baseball. The Rays shortstop’s at-bat continued until the count was full, at which point the umpires convened in an attempt to sort out what the actual count should be.

The umps went to instant replay, then still declared the count was full after review.

Escobar ended up striking out after he should have been awarded first base. Major League Baseball acknowledged the mistake in a statement following the game, but Escobar must wish the error could have been corrected the first time.
